From time to time you may need to block particular third parties from accessing your sites. There are a number of automatic bots that crawl the Internet, for instance, and generate fake visits and site traffic. There are spammers who leave links to questionable Internet sites as comments to website articles. Such things can greatly undermine your projects, because nobody likes to visit a site with countless fake comments, not to mention that the increased site traffic from both spammers and bots could generate high load on the web server on which your site is hosted, which can result in your site not working properly. One of the best solutions in cases like this is to block the IP addresses which generate the fake traffic, so as to be sure that the visits to your website are real.
